Resonance Speci., a microcap player in the Specialty Chemicals sector, has experienced a revision in its market evaluation reflecting a more cautious outlook. This adjustment follows a detailed review of the company’s financial and technical parameters, highlighting a complex interplay of valuation concerns and operational trends.



Understanding the Shift in Market Assessment


The recent revision in Resonance Speci.’s evaluation metrics stems from a comprehensive analysis across four key dimensions: quality, valuation, financial trend, and technical outlook. Each of these factors contributes to the overall market perception and investor sentiment surrounding the stock.



Quality Metrics Reflect Average Operational Performance


Examining the company’s quality indicators reveals an average standing. Over the past five years, net sales have expanded at an annual rate of 6.9%, while operating profit growth has been notably subdued at 0.77% per annum. This modest growth trajectory suggests that while the company maintains steady operations, it has not demonstrated significant acceleration in core business performance.



Valuation Signals Point to Elevated Pricing


From a valuation perspective, Resonance Speci. is positioned on the expensive side. The stock trades at a price-to-book value of approximately 1.7, which is relatively high for a microcap entity. Despite this, the valuation aligns fairly with historical averages observed among its peers in the Specialty Chemicals sector. The company’s return on equity (ROE) stands at 11.3%, indicating moderate profitability relative to shareholder equity.



Financial Trends Show Positive Profit Growth Amid Mixed Returns


Financially, the company has exhibited a positive trend in profitability, with profits rising by nearly 65% over the past year. However, this profit growth contrasts with the stock’s market returns, which have been less favourable. Over the last twelve months, the stock has generated a return of approximately -3.5%, underperforming the broader BSE500 benchmark consistently over the past three years. This divergence between profit growth and share price performance may reflect investor concerns about sustainability or other external factors affecting market sentiment.



Technical Indicators Suggest Mildly Bearish Momentum


On the technical front, the stock exhibits mildly bearish signals. Short-term price movements have been relatively flat, with a day change of 0.0%, a one-week gain of 3.49%, and a one-month increase of 4.15%. However, longer-term trends reveal a decline, with a three-month return of -1.6% and a six-month drop nearing 19%. These patterns indicate that while there may be intermittent buying interest, the overall momentum remains subdued.

Sector and Market Capitalisation Context


Resonance Speci. operates within the Specialty Chemicals sector, a segment characterised by niche product offerings and variable growth dynamics. As a microcap company, its market capitalisation is relatively small, which often translates into higher volatility and sensitivity to market fluctuations. This status can influence investor appetite and liquidity considerations, especially when compared to larger, more established peers.



Stock Performance Relative to Benchmarks


Over the past year, Resonance Speci.’s stock has delivered a modest positive return of 1.79% year-to-date, yet it has declined by 3.48% over the full twelve-month period. This performance contrasts with the broader market indices, where the BSE500 has generally outpaced the stock. The consistent underperformance over three consecutive years highlights challenges in translating operational improvements into sustained shareholder value.
